Anais Beatriz Snape Amador was never meant to exist - not in the eyes of the Ministry, the Death Eaters, or even her own mother. Born of shadow and legacy, she arrives at Hogwarts cloaked in secrecy, her name whispered in pureblood halls and feared in others. A Slytherin by birthright, a weapon by design, Anais is as brilliant as she is dangerous. Her presence is cold, commanding, and calculated - perfectly curated to hide the truth no one can ever know: she is the illegitimate daughter of Severus Snape. But everything begins to unravel during the year of the Triwizard Tournament. As chaos descends on the castle and dark magic weaves its way back into the world, Anais finds herself drawn into a storm of secrets, seduction, and betrayal. At the heart of it all is Mattheo Riddle - the darkly magnetic son of Lord Voldemort, and every bit as cursed as the name he bears. Their rivalry simmers with unspoken tension, threatening to ignite into something far more destructive. But while Mattheo ignites the fire, it's Theodore Nott who watches it burn - silent, calculating, always two steps ahead. He sees through every mask Anais wears, every lie she tells herself, and offers something Mattheo never could: control. Between them, she's caught in a game of pull and push - chaos and calm, fury and stillness. And standing beside her, always, is Lorenzo Berkshire - her oldest friend, her steady compass in a world that seems intent on tearing her apart. As whispers of war rise from the ashes of the past, Anais must choose between legacy and loyalty, vengeance and vulnerability. Because the truth is coming. The masks are slipping. And when bloodlines are weapons and love is a liability, survival means becoming more than a name. He is the son of a monster. She is the girl bred to survive one. Neither asked to be pawns in this game. This isn't a fairytale. This is Slytherin love - sharp, seductive, and bound to ruin.
